Cannabis is grown from one of two sources: a seed or a clone. Seeds bring genetic details from two moms and dad plants and can express lots of different mixes of characteristics: some from the mother, some from the dad, and some traits from both. In commercial cannabis production, usually, growers will plant numerous seeds of one stress and select the very best plant. They will then take clones from that private plant, which permits consistent genetics for mass production. Growing from seed can produce a more powerful plant with more strong genetics. Plants grown from seed can be more hearty as young plants when compared to clones, mainly since seeds have a strong taproot. You can plant seeds straight into an outside garden in early spring, even in cool, damp environments. If growing outside, some growers choose to germinate seeds inside since they are fragile in the beginning phases of growth. Inside your home, you can give weed seedlings extra light to help them along, and after that transplant them outside when big enough. Sexing cannabis plants can be a lengthy process, and if you don't capture males, there is a danger that even one males can pollinate your entire crop, causing all of your female weed plants to produce seeds. One method to prevent sexing plants is to buy feminized seeds (more listed below), which makes sure every seed you plant will be a bud-producing woman. You can likewise decrease headaches and avoid the trouble of seed germination and sexing plants by beginning with clones.
A clone is a cutting that is genetically similar to the plant it was taken fromthat plant is called the "mother." Through cloning, you can produce a new harvest with specific replicas of your preferred plant. cheap autoflowering seeds. Due to the fact that genes are similar, a clone will offer you a plant with the very same characteristics as the mother, such as taste, cannabinoid profile, yield, grow time, and so on. So if you come across a specific stress or phenotype you really like, you may want to clone it to replicate more buds that have the very same effects and characteristics - feminized seeds for sale. With cloning, you do not have to get brand-new seeds whenever you wish to grow another plantyou simply take a cutting of the old plantand you do not have to germinate seeds or sex them out and eliminate the males.
Another drawback to clones is they can take on unfavorable qualities from the mother plant as well. If the mother has an illness, draws in insects, or grows weak branches, its clones will most likely have the very same issues. Furthermore, every long-time grower will inform you that clones degrade with time. Feminized marijuana seeds will produce just female plants for getting buds, so there is no requirement to get rid of males or worry about female plants getting pollinated. Feminized seeds are produced by causing the monoecious condition in a female marijuana plantthe resulting seeds are nearly similar to the self-pollinated female moms and dad, as just one set of genes exists.
This is achieved through a number of techniques: By spraying the plant with a solution of colloidal silver, a liquid containing tiny particles of silver, Through a method referred to as rodelization, in which a female plant pushed past maturity can pollinate another female, Spraying seeds with gibberellic acid, a hormonal agent that triggers germination (this is much less common) Many skilled or business growers will not use feminized seeds since they just include one set of genes, and these need to never be used for breeding purposes. Nevertheless, a great deal of starting growers start with feminized seeds due to the fact that they get rid of the concern of needing to handle male plants. autoflower marijuana seeds.

They are easy to grow because you do not have to fret about light cycles and just how much light a plant gets. Many marijuana plants begin blooming when the amount of light they receive daily decreases (feminized seeds). Outdoors, this occurs when the sun starts setting previously in the day as the season turns from summertime to autumn. best feminized seeds. Indoor growers can manage when a plant flowers by lowering the everyday amount of light plants get from 18 hours to 12 hours.
Autoflowers can be started in early spring and will flower during the longest days of summer, benefiting from high quality light to grow yields. Or, if you get a late start in the growing season, you can start autoflowers in May or June and harvest in the fall. Also, autoflower plants are smallperfect for closet grows or any little grow, or growing outdoors where you don't want your neighbors to see what you depend on. A couple big drawbacks, though: Autoflower pressures are known for being less powerful. Likewise, due to the fact that they are little in stature, they normally do not produce huge yields.
Autoflowering strains require some preparation, as they will grow rapidly and begin to flower whether or not you're prepared for them. Many cannabis growers start autoflowers early in the season, and at a various time than a regular crop, so keep the season and environment in mind when growing and harvestingyour plants still need heat to grow, and rain can provide bud rot - what are feminized seeds. Think about growing in a greenhouse to protect them. Because training occurs during vegetative growth, for autoflowering plants, this duration could be as brief as a few weeks, which means time is restricted. Try your autoflowers after they have 3 nodes, and stop once they begin to flower.
Autoflowers don't require great deals of nutrients since they're little and don't spend much time in the vegetative cycle. They will not need as much veg nutrientssuch as nitrogenbut will require more bloom nutrients. CBD, or cannabidiol, is among the chemical componentsknown jointly as cannabinoidsfound in the cannabis plant. For many years, people have chosen plants for high-THC material, making cannabis with high levels of CBD unusual. The hereditary paths through which THC is synthesized by the plant are various than those for CBD production. Marijuana utilized for hemp production has actually been selected for other qualities, consisting of a low THC material, so regarding abide by the 2018 Farm Costs.
As interest in CBD as a medication has actually grown, lots of breeders have actually crossed high-CBD hemp with marijuana. These pressures have little or no THC, 1:1 ratios of THC and CBD, or some have a high-THC content together with considerable quantities of CBD (3% or more). Seeds for these varieties are now widely offered online and through dispensaries. It must be kept in mind, however, that any plant grown from these seeds is not ensured to produce high levels of CBD, as it takes several years to create a seed line that produces consistent outcomes - feminized marijauna seeds. A grower aiming to produce marijuana with a certain THC to CBD ratio will require to grow from an evaluated and shown clone or seed.

There are numerous approaches to germinate seeds, but for the most common and most basic method, you will require: 2 tidy plates, 4 paper towels, Seeds, Pure water Take 4 sheets of paper towels and soak them with distilled water. The towels should be soaked but should not have excess water running.
Then, position the marijuana seeds a minimum of an inch apart from each other and cover them with the staying two water-soaked paper towels (feminized autoflowering seeds usa). To create a dark, protected space, take another plate and flip it over to cover the seeds, like a dome. Make certain the location the seeds remain in is warm, someplace in between 70-85F. After completing these steps, it's time to wait. Check the paper towels as soon as a day to make certain they're still saturated, and if they are losing wetness, use more water to keep the seeds pleased. Some seeds sprout very rapidly while others can take a while, however usually, seeds need to germinate in 3-10 days.
A seed has actually germinated once the seed divides and a single grow appears. The grow is the taproot, which will end up being the main stem of the plant, and seeing it is a sign of effective germination. It is essential to keep the fragile seed sterile, so don't touch the seed or taproot as it starts to split - what are feminized seeds. As soon as you see the taproot, it's time to move your sprouted seed into its growing medium, such as soil. what is autoflowering seeds. Fill a 4-inch or one-gallon pot with loose, airy potting soil, Water the soil before you put the seed in; it needs to be wet however not soaked, Poke a hole in the soil with a pen or pencilthe rule of thumb is: make the hole twice as deep as the seed is large, Using a pair of tweezers, carefully place the seed in the hole with the taproot facing down, Gently cover it with soil Keep a close eye on the temperature level and wetness level of the soil to keep the seed delighted.
